Case Extension Assemble (FWD Only)





1. Inspect the case extension assembly (6) for the following conditions:
^ A damaged or porous sealing surface for the case extension seal
^ A damaged or porous sealing surface for the vehicle speed sensor
^ A damaged or porous sealing surface for the right drive shaft oil seal assembly
^ Damaged bolt holes
^ A worn or damaged front differential carrier bushing (7A) or output shaft bearing assembly (713)
^ A porous or damaged case extension housing





2. Install the differential carrier/case selective thrust washer (714) onto the differential/final drive carrier assembly (700).
3. Install the thrust bearing (715) onto the differential/final drive carrier assembly (700).
4. Affix the seal (8) onto the case extension (6).
5. Install the case extension assembly (6) onto the case (3).

Notice: Refer to Fastener Notice in Service Precautions.

6. Install only two case extension bolts (5) for later removal.
^ Tighten the bolts until the extension is flush to the case.
